2. What does it MEAN?
– But: This brings to mind the context of this verse, and it shows that this verse is in contrast with the previous verse.

° Context: While emphasizing on the liberty received from the law because righteousness can now be obtained by faith in Christ. Apostle Paul admonishes that this liberty should not be used as an occasion to walk in the flesh; rather we should serve one another by love, walking in the Spirit. Apostle Paul then describes the fruits of the flesh and the fruits of the Spirit with an emphasis that; “Walk in the Spirit and you would not fulfil the lust of the flesh”. This is the law of liberty, to walk in the Spirit, exhibiting the fruits of the Spirit in our day-to-day activities.

– the fruit of the Spirit: Fruit refers to a produce, a yield, what comes from a certain or specific tree/ plant. Hence, the fruit of the Spirit is something that yields from the Spirit, it refers to a character, attitude, or behavior that comes from the Spirit, which is manifest in anyone that is walking in the Spirit. And much more uniquely, these fruits are only sponsored by the Spirit of God, making them flow supernaturally and remain consistent in every situation. Any look alike that is not sponsored by the Spirit of God is eventually used to walk in the flesh.

– love: agapē – brotherly love, affection, good will, love, benevolence. Love God with all your heart, mind and soul; love your neighbor as yourself. This remains the first and second greatest commandment, and all through the scripture it has being proven to be the base of everything that is of God. Even if I give my body to be burnt for others, and I have not love, it amounts to nothing before God. (Matthew 22: 36 – 40, 1 Corinthians 13: 1 – 13) The fruit of the Spirit is always characterized by love.

– Joy: chara – joy, gladness, cheerfulness I.e. calm delight. With love flowing this much, appreciating the love of God and loving men after the pattern of God’s love for mankind; it gives so much more room for joy to flow. Joy is a fruit of the Spirit; you can’t find joy? Focus on walking in the Spirit, you have the fruit of joy through the Holy Spirit.

– Peace: eirēnē – a state of tranquility, peace between individuals, i.e. harmony, concord; security, safety, prosperity, felicity, (because peace and harmony make and keep things safe and prosperous).

Heads-up, peace is a fruit of the Spirit, it is sponsored by God; depression, anxiety, restlessness and the likes of them are not the fruit of the Spirit. As believers in Christ, God has ordained that we walk in peace, inward peace and outward expression of peace; we receive this by faith. Regardless of age, economy, gene, past sins, national situation; they are not a hindrance, the peace of God can still flow in and through you. Choose to walk in the Spirit, appropriate these things which God has freely given and ordained by faith.

– longsuffering: makrothumia – patience, endurance, constancy, steadfastness, perseverance, forbearance, longsuffering, slowness in avenging wrongs.

– gentleness: chrēstotēs – moral goodness, integrity, benignity, kindness. (Benignity is the quality of being kind, gently and mild.)

– goodness: agathōsunē – uprightness of heart and life, goodness, kindness

– faith: pistis – conviction of truth, a strong and welcome conviction or belief that Jesus is the Messiah, through whom we obtain eternal salvation in the kingdom of God.

– meekness: praotēs – gentleness, mildness, meekness

– temperance: egkrateia – self-control (the virtue of one who masters his desires and passions, especially his sensual appetites)
